Pawar accuses Centre of destabilizing non-BJP governed states, says ‘MVA will complete its term and come to power again’

Accusing the Union government of trying to destabilize non-BJP governed states, Nationalist Congress Party chief (NCP) supremo Sharad Pawar said that investigation agencies like CBI, ED, IT and NCB are being misused.

Addressing a gathering in Pune, Pawar said that Maharashtra’s Maha Vikas Aghadi government will complete its 5 years term and will return to power again.

When asked about the extension of BSF’s operational jurisdiction, Pawar said he will be meeting Home Minister Amit Shah t know his thoughts about it. 

This is not the first time, Pawar has slammed the Central government agencies.

Earlier this month, he termed the I-T raids on his nephew and Maharashtra Deputy Chief Minister Ajit Pawar’s relatives, because he had compared the Lakhimpur Kheri violence to the Jallianwala Bagh massacre.

“Don’t we have the right to air our views in democracy?” he had asked.

This statement from the Maratha satrap comes after Chief Minister Uddhav Thackeray made similar allegations against the BJP-led Union government while addressing the traditional Dussehra rally in Mumbai 

Thackeray had said that Shiv Sena is not scared of the Central Bureau of Investigation (CBI) and Enforcement Directorate (ED).

“Shivaji Maharaj and party founder Balasaheb taught them that they should not be afraid of anything. We are not the ones to hide behind Police after making threats,” he had said.

Launching a scathing attack on his former ally BJP, Uddhav said that “Hindutva” was facing threat from those who used it to get power and the hunger for power was like “drug addiction”.

Accusing the BJP of maligning Maharashtra, he said, “They call Mumbai police mafia, what will you call the UP police then?”

Reacting to his remark that the Centre is using the drugs-on-cruise case to defame the state, BJP leader Devendra Fadnavis said that Uddhav’s name will be recorded as the chief of the most corrupt government in Maharashtra.

“If we had to use central agencies, then half of your ministers would have been in jail. But we believe in democracy. Our Prime Minister believes in ethical politics. There has never been a misuse of agencies through his medium,” he added.
